Navigating Car Insurance Companies in Fairplay, Colorado: A Local's Guide to Coverage
Living in Fairplay, Colorado, presents a unique blend of rugged mountain living and small-town charm, but it also comes with specific challenges for drivers. When evaluating car insurance companies, Fairplay residents need to consider factors that might not be as critical in urban areas. The high-altitude environment, severe winter weather with heavy snowfall on highways like US 285, and the prevalence of wildlife crossings mean your auto policy must be robust. Local insurance providers and national carriers familiar with Park County risks often offer the most tailored coverage. It's wise to seek out car insurance companies that understand the increased likelihood of weather-related claims, from hail damage to collisions on icy roads, which are common during our long winters. Beyond the basics, consider adding comprehensive coverage for animal strikes, as encounters with deer, elk, and moose are frequent on rural routes around South Park. Another key consideration is the distance to repair shops. Fairplay's remote location means a minor fender-bender could require a tow to Denver or Colorado Springs, leading to higher costs. Some car insurance companies include enhanced roadside assistance or higher rental car allowances in their policies, which can be invaluable here. Always ask about these specifics when comparing quotes. For Fairplay drivers, liability limits mandated by Colorado law are just the starting point. Given the terrain and weather, increasing your collision and comprehensive deductibles might save on premiums, but ensure you have savings to cover them if an incident occurs. It's also beneficial to inquire about discounts for safety features like four-wheel drive, which many locals use, or for bundling with homeowners insurance, especially relevant given the area's mix of historic homes and newer builds. Engaging with local independent agents can be particularly advantageous. These professionals often represent multiple car insurance companies and have firsthand knowledge of Fairplay's driving conditions. They can help you navigate the nuances of coverage for seasonal residents, as some properties are vacation homes, or for vehicles used for both commuting and recreational activities like skiing or off-roading.
